Wet Waste Treatment Plant: Yangpu District Wet Waste Resource Utilization and Disposal Center

The transport vehicle will dump all the garbage into a huge raw material pool, and the gripper of the garbage crane will lift and drain the garbage raw materials, and place them on the chain plate machine. The chain plate machine will transport the garbage to the crusher for bag breaking treatment. The garbage will be screened along the conveyor belt, and the screened wet garbage will undergo fermentation. The remaining screened plastic bags, metal objects, etc. will be loaded onto trucks and transported away.

Dry garbage treatment plant: Laogang Waste Treatment Park

The park has a waste incineration plant and a landfill site, which undertake the dry waste treatment of most of the urban areas in Shanghai. Shanghai generates over 20000 tons of household waste per day, while incineration plants process only 3000 tons of waste per day. Through the recycling of renewable energy, the annual power generation exceeds 300 million kilowatt hours. Any excess dry waste will be landfilled, occupying a large amount of land resources, and it will take over a hundred years to restore the land. The leachate and smoke generated during the incineration process of garbage will be further treated, and the water vapor will drive the generator to generate electricity. The incineration residue will be comprehensively utilized, most of which will be made into road bricks.

The transported garbage is first poured into the raw material pool and crushed, drained, and other operations are carried out by an 8-ton gripper crane. Sometimes the garbage needs to be drained for a week because the lower the moisture content in the garbage, the better.

During the incineration process, garbage needs to go through a series of procedures such as grabbing, mixing, stacking, feeding, and weighing before entering the incinerator to complete the entire process flow. All of these tasks require a garbage crane to complete, so the control of the garbage crane is particularly important throughout the entire garbage power generation process.

Before incineration, the garbage needs to be compressed into blocks, and the dual synchronous oil cylinder on the garbage compressor needs to have accurate height every time.

Garbage incineration is the process of reducing the volume of garbage through appropriate thermal decomposition, combustion, melting, and other reactions at high temperatures, resulting in residue or molten solid material. Garbage incineration facilities must be equipped with smoke treatment facilities to prevent heavy metals, organic pollutants, etc. from being discharged into the environmental medium again. Recycling the heat generated by garbage incineration can achieve the goal of waste resource utilization. Garbage incineration is an ancient traditional method of treating garbage. Due to its ability to reduce waste, save land, eliminate various pathogens, and transform toxic and harmful substances into harmless ones, incineration has become one of the main methods for urban garbage treatment. Modern garbage incinerators are equipped with good smoke and dust purification devices to reduce air pollution.

To get back to the point, starting from July 1st, after the official implementation of the new Shanghai Municipal Solid Waste Management Regulations, the difficulty of garbage classification has not yet exceeded people's daily cognitive scope. However, when people really stand at the fork in the road between dry and wet garbage, many people will still be confused for a while.

For example, melon seeds are dry, but they do wet garbage; Wet wipes are wet, but they are dry garbage. The paper used to wrap dog poop is dry, and the poop needs to be taken home and poured into the toilet. Similarly, pig bones belong to dry garbage, while chicken bones belong to wet garbage;

This mysterious classification method is related to the final processing steps of wet garbage. After arriving at the garbage treatment plant, wet garbage will be first crushed by a semi wet material crusher, while hard kitchen waste such as shells and pig bones, which belong to dry garbage, will clog the blades of the crusher. Similarly, dry Zongzi leaves and corn husks are also difficult to cut, even winding the blade to reduce the efficiency of pulverization. In addition, this kind of garbage will not easily rot and dissolve when thrown into the fermentation tank.
